Differential expression of functional chemokine receptors on human blood and lung group 2 innate lymphoid cells (ILC2s).

Differential expression of chemokine receptors on lymphocytes enables tissue and disease specific recruitment and activation of various lymphocytes. We have shown that human ILC2s display a different subset of functional chemokine receptors when isolated from blood or lung tissue.
